Компания больше не ищет сотрудника. Посмотрите похожие предложения

Старший разработчик на Go (Service Mesh)
в Yandex Infrastructure
250 000 — 450 000 ₽/мес на руки
Технологии/инструменты
Наша группа входит в структуру Platform Engineering в Яндексе. Мы развиваем инфраструктурное контейнерное облако, в котором расположены сервисы, создаваемые тысячами разработчиков Яндекса. Всё ради того, чтобы запуск и эксплуатация сервиса занимали минимум времени, а стоимость ресурсов облака была минимальной. Под управлением внутреннего облака находятся более 110 тысяч серверов и заведено более 50 тысяч приложений — суммарно около миллиона контейнеров. Ближайший его аналог — Kubernetes, но наше решение позволяет запускать сервисы в одной инсталляции, масштабированной на весь Яндекс. В нашем облаке развёрнуты как крупные потребители, например Поиск или MapReduce в лице YT, так и микросервисы, которые хоть и крошечные, зато их многие десятки тысяч — это, например, весь сервис Такси.
Мы не только помогаем запускать сервисы, но и даём пользователю всё, что нужно, чтобы эти сервисы эксплуатировать: настраиваем балансировку, предоставляем мониторинг поднятых сервисов, собираем логи, поддерживаем интеграцию с CI/CD и не только.
Относительно новое направление у нас — разработка единой инфраструктурной платформы (PaaS), которая объединяет в себе инфраструктурные сервисы и позволяет:
- Скрыть от разработчика лишнюю сложность по созданию и настройке своего сервиса.
- Хранить настройки сервиса рядом с кодом и применять GitOps-подходы при разработке своих сервисов.
Основная часть платформы разрабатывается на Go, ещё мы активно используем компоненты Kubernetes, и ряд инструментов написан на Python.
Service Mesh — концепция и важная подсистема платформы, позволяющая управлять взаимодействием микросервисов друг с другом.
Мы ищем опытного разработчика, который будет участвовать в развитии и поддержке платформы, а также в интеграции Service Mesh с другими её компонентами.
Какие задачи вас ждут
- Проектирование и развитие Service Mesh.
Вам предстоит разрабатывать компоненты Service Mesh на Go для управления взаимодействием микросервисов: маршрутизацией, балансировкой, политиками безопасности. Вы будете оптимизировать производительность Mesh-слоя в масштабах всей платформы, реализовывать механизмы трассировки, мониторинга и сбора метрик для анализа сетевых взаимодействий.
- Интеграция с PaaS-платформой.
Вашей задачей будет глубокая интеграция Service Mesh с другими компонентами платформы: CI/CD, оркестрацией контейнеров, системами логирования. Предстоит разрабатывать API и инструменты для настройки Mesh-правил через GitOps-подход (хранение конфигураций рядом с кодом), создавать прозрачный интерфейс для разработчиков, скрывающий сложность Mesh-инфраструктуры.
- Обеспечение надёжности и безопасности.
Вы будете реализовывать механизмы mTLS, авторизации и управления политиками доступа между сервисами, проектировать отказоустойчивую архитектуру Mesh-слоя, включая автоматическое восстановление при сбоях, а также участвовать в нагрузочном тестировании и оптимизации сетевых протоколов: gRPC, HTTP/2.
- Работа с инфраструктурными вызовами.
Нужно будет устранять узкие места в работе Mesh-платформы на уровне сети и операционной системы (Linux, сетевые стеки), адаптировать опенсорс-решения (например, Envoy, Istio) под внутренние требования Яндекса. Также вы будете участвовать в масштабировании системы для поддержки экосистемы из тысяч микросервисов и крупных продуктов: Поиска, YT, Такси.
Мы ждем, что вы
- Занимались промышленной разработкой на Go или Python от трёх лет.
- Применяли в работе классические алгоритмы.
- Знаете классические структуры данных и особенности работы с ними в Go и Python.
Будет плюсом, если вы
- Проектировали и разрабатывали распределённые и высоконагруженные сервисы.
- Владеете проблематикой построения облачных сервисов.
- Глубоко знаете Linux.
- Занимались многопоточным и асинхронным программированием.
- Имеете опыт сетевого программирования.
Условия
Здоровье
Расширенная медицинская страховка начинает работать с первого месяца в Яндексе. В неё входят стоматология, ежегодные чекапы, неотложная помощь за рубежом, лечение критических заболеваний, в том числе онкологии, и страхование от несчастных случаев.
А также
- Психотерапия в офисе или на онлайн-сервисах.
- Лазерная коррекция зрения через год работы.
- Ведение беременности и роды — через два года.
Страховка для родственников по системе 80/20
- Мы оплачиваем 80% стоимости ДМС для детей и супругов, вы — остальные 20%.
Рост и развитие
В Яндексе есть всё, чтобы постоянно развиваться и учиться новому: внутренняя образовательная платформа, менторство и программы для начинающих и опытных руководителей.
А также
- Оплата участия в профильных конференциях.
- Скидка 50% на изучение иностранных языков.
Кроме того, в Яндексе есть внутренние проекты, где наши сотрудники делятся экспертизой, обсуждают сложные темы и разбирают кейсы своих проектов.
Спорт
Во всех крупных офисах Яндекса есть спортзалы со всем необходимым: тренажёрами, спортивным инвентарём, душевыми, шкафчиками для одежды и вещей. Можете заниматься самостоятельно, а можете с корпоративным тренером.
А также
- Бесплатные онлайн-тренировки с FITMOST.
- Скидки в фитнес-клубах, бассейнах, студиях йоги, скалодромах и других местах.
Спортивный клуб Яндекса
- В Яндексе есть спортивный клуб и много спортивных команд. У них есть свои лидеры, чаты, программы тренировок. А ещё они регулярно участвуют в забегах, триатлонах, «Гонке героев», футбольных и других соревнованиях. Вы сможете присоединиться к существующим командам или собрать свою.
И ещё
- Гибкий график. У нас нет фиксированного времени начала и конца рабочего дня — работайте так, как удобно вам и вашей команде.
- Жилищные займы. Льготная ставка на покупку жилья и улучшение жилищных условий — в зависимости от стажа, позиции и результатов ревью. Действует для сотрудников, работающих в российских офисах Яндекса.
- Всё для детей. Страхование, детские дни в офисе, подарки на рождение детей и чекапы при планировании беременности.


О компании Yandex Infrastructure
Команда Yandex Infrastructure создаёт и предоставляет внутреннюю инфраструктуру Яндекса — фундамент из продуктов и технологий, на базе которого тысячи инженеров разрабатывают, деплоят и эксплуатируют основные сервисы Яндекса: Поиск, Такси, Маркет, Алису, Кинопоиск и многие другие.